4th Annual Hug-a-Horse: Suicide Prevention Month
Advertisement
Join us for the 4th Annual Hug-a-Horse at Tacktics in Galena.
A free community event in recognition of Suicide Prevention Month, Hug-a-Horse welcomes the community to come onto Tacktics' 200 acre facility with over 20 rescued horses. While the horses roam and graze naturally, you'll be able to mingle with them, hug them, pet them, or sit in the field and just be.
We will have blue and purple ribbons available and we encourage you to tie them in the manes of the horses in symbolization of someone you have lost to suicide.
We have 2 evenings this year, September 10th and 14th, 5-7pm each night.
- Children are allowed but please remember the reason for this event. It is not a free children's activity to see the horses. Children must have an adult with them *at all times* keeping energy and volume low and respecting other peoples space.
- No dogs allowed onsite.
